The role

We have an exciting brand new opportunity for a Warranty Case Consultant to join our Toll Transitions team in Brisbane QLD.

Toll Transitions is a business unit that provides Defence Members & their families with a comprehensive end to end relocation service.

As a Warranty Case Consultant, you will contribute to this by assisting ADF Members as well as Corporate and Government clients with notices or claims for Loss or Damage.

In doing so, you will have the opportunity to provide service recovery and leave a positive impression with our clients.

If you are a dedicated individual who is passionate about ensuring customer satisfaction and resolving issues efficiently, this is the role for youAs the Warranty Case Consultant, your responsibilities will include:
Efficiently manage the end-to-end warranty claims process, from initial claim submission to resolution.
This includes accurately documenting claims, assessing validity, and coordinating with relevant stakeholders to expedite resolution.
Conduct thorough investigations into warranty claims to determine root causes and validity.
Serve as the primary point of contact for customers submitting warranty claims.
Provide clear and timely communication regarding claim status, resolution timelines, and any additional information required.
Collaborate closely with other stakeholders to gather relevant information and ensure timely resolution of claims.
Maintain policy compliance and accurate record keeping at all times.
Strive to exceed customer expectations and foster positive relationships.
